I have had melasma on my face since I was 30 years old.
over the years it has taken on a greyish tint. I have used triluma for the first couple of years with sucess, but then the melasma got a little out of hand. i went to the dermatologist in savannah and she recommended the IPL treatment. After looking at my skins, she told me it would be a minimum of 2 treatments, but may take up to six. I was very sceptical, but at this point what did I have to lose?
I went for my spot check, which tested areas of the skin based on a particular frequency. The cost of this was $75. I also elected to undergo facial hair removal with the IPL treatment. The facail cream that I was using to remove hair from my upper lip was causing melasma due to the skin becoming inflamed after treatment. My first IPL treatment was actually much to my surprise, very successfull. It took 45 minutes. She put goggles on me to protect my eyes and then began the treamtment. It stings a little, much like a rubber band, and I jumped everytime i knew she was going to press on my face- but on a scale of 1-10, i would say the pain was a 3. Within a few days, the hair on my upper lip was falling out! I was completly shocked that it actually worked! The melasma is significantly lighter. In fact, I thing I will only need one more treatment. The hair only grew back in one tiny little patch on my upper lip, and when I tweeze it, the hair releases easily. It has been
3 weeks as of this date. The treatment with the hari removal cost me $425. I will go again in 2 weeks.
I would definetly recomend this to any one!! Just so you know, I am white and hair dark brown hair and brown eyes. I am told it works best with people who have my skin tone and eye/hair color. I will let you all know how the second treatment goes!

The ipl used on me was the palomar starlux. i missed my last treatment, so it has been 4 weeks since i have had this done. my skin looks so good! im anxious to go again. I have stopped the Triluma because I have been on it since May. I will have to see with the next treament how my skin does. my next appt is on August 29.
